9,509 Steps to Miles, By Height

The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 9,509 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.

HeightDistance
Short (~5'2")3.85 mi
Average (~5'7")4.16 mi
Tall (~6'2")4.60 mi

Where 9,509 Steps Ranks

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 9,509 steps falls.

Activity LevelDaily Steps
SedentaryUnder 5,000
Low Active5,000–7,499
Somewhat Active7,500–9,999
Active10,000–12,499
Highly Active12,500+

Charles Darwin walked a fixed loop near his home every day, he called it his "Sandwalk" and used it to think through his ideas, including parts of what became On the Origin of Species.
